diff src/aac/mp4ff/mp4ff.h @ 451:5826c77f4acf trunk

[svn] - various overflow and security-related fixes from XMMS2 (mainly Juho Vaha-Herttua, et al)
author nenolod
date Wed, 17 Jan 2007 00:56:53 -0800
parents 3da1b8942b8b
children 3d6a2732f26a
line wrap: on
line diff
--- a/src/aac/mp4ff/mp4ff.h	Wed Jan 17 00:29:28 2007 -0800
+++ b/src/aac/mp4ff/mp4ff.h	Wed Jan 17 00:56:53 2007 -0800
@@ -87,6 +87,7 @@
 int mp4ff_meta_get_num_items(const mp4ff_t *f);
 int mp4ff_meta_get_by_index(const mp4ff_t *f, unsigned int index,
                             char **item, char **value);
+int mp4ff_meta_find_by_name(const mp4ff_t *f, const char *item, char **value);
 int mp4ff_meta_get_title(const mp4ff_t *f, char **value);
 int mp4ff_meta_get_artist(const mp4ff_t *f, char **value);
 int mp4ff_meta_get_writer(const mp4ff_t *f, char **value);
@@ -107,6 +108,7 @@
 {
     char *item;
     char *value;
+    uint32_t value_length;
 } mp4ff_tag_t;
 
 /* metadata list structure */